Introducing DevOps practices into an organization requires demonstrating their value, especially since change can often be met with resistance. The process involves understanding current workflows, identifying repetitive tasks that can be automated, and promoting a cultural shift in communication and collaboration. By focusing on small, manageable changes, such as automating routine tasks or streamlining onboarding processes, teams can gradually embrace DevOps principles. Sharing the successes and efficiencies gained with other teams can help build momentum for wider adoption. Incremental improvements and cultural integration of DevOps practices can save time and resources, ultimately enhancing productivity and innovation.
